Fluke 1742/B/EUS Power Logger Repair
The Fluke 1742/B/EUS is a three-phase power quality logger (1740 series, B-kit/EUS configuration) that records voltage, current, power, energy, harmonics, and PQ data to IEC 61000-4-30 Class S across all phases with flexible current probes. Its accuracy depends on the voltage and current measurement inputs, so that’s where service and calibration focus.
